- Announced this morning, Amazon Prime Day will take place from Tuesday, July 8, through Friday, July 11.
- This is the longest Prime Day ever, with Amazon effectively doubling its typical sale period.
- We’re seeing early deals on outdoor equipment ranging from Yeti coolers to camp chairs to portable grills.
Prime Day is one of the more anticipated online savings events of not only the summer, but the entire year. This morning, Amazon pulled the curtain back on its 2025 dates, and this year’s Prime Day is officially slated for July 8-11—a full four days of discounts compared to the usual two.

We’re seeing plenty of discounts on camping gear, too. This durable yet cozy two-person Sundome Tent from Coleman is almost 30 percent off. With a 35-square-foot footprint, it’s relatively roomy for a two-person shelter. And the welded corners and inverted seams help prevent water from getting in. The extra bright Coleman LED Lantern is now 31 percent off, and the energy-efficient device will be a godsend on hiking and camping trips. It’s super bright and weather-resistant, while the long handle makes it easy to rig up on a bit of cord for area lighting.
